My Name is Maame by Awaeke Emezi is a beautifully written coming-of-age novel that explores identity, belonging, and the complexities of family life.
The story follows Maame, a young girl navigating the challenges of growing up while balancing her personal desires with family expectations. Through struggles, joys, and self-discovery, Maame learns to embrace who she truly is and finds strength in her resilience.
Rich in cultural context and emotional depth, this novel speaks to anyone who has faced challenges of identity, heritage, and personal growth, making it both a relatable and inspiring read.
